As the title suggests I've got a room with old quarry tiles on ash. They are nice and level and very stable so I that respect perfect for laying a floating floor over them.
The issue I have is damp. The tiles used to be covered by a cheap foam backed carpet (before I bought the house!) and this didn't allow the quarry tiles to breath. Consequently the damp meter was off the scale. Now I've ripped up the carpet the tiles are fine and dry.
So my question; if I lay engineered boards and an underlay over the quarry tiles, will the damp return?
